Bephyer Parey; Elisabeth Kutscher – Journal of Mixed Methods Research, 2024
Rigor evaluation in mixed methods research is a growing need. Linking rigor to Hong and Pluye's (2019) concepts of methodological and reporting quality, the purpose of this article is to operationalize and expand Harrison et al.'s (2020) Rigorous Mixed Methods Framework. Drawing from a systematic methodological review of 66 inclusive education…

Harrison, Robert L.; Reilly, Timothy M.; Creswell, John W. – Journal of Mixed Methods Research, 2020
As mixed methods continues to grow as a discipline, work to define what constitutes quality mixed methods research has become an emergent conversation. While progress has been made in this area, there has been some debate as to what quality entails and how to achieve it. This article contributes to mixed methods by highlighting the importance of…
